Dear all

The X2Go project is proud to announce a new release of the X2Go
component ,,nx-libs''.

This release, as usual, tracks the release as tagged by The Arctica Project.

For more information, please refer to https://arctica-project.org/ and
especially https://github.com/ArcticaProject/nx-libs, where most development
takes place.

New gains of this version of ,,nx-libs'' are:

  o clipboard handling overhaul
  o fixed segfault in argument parsing if the passed parameter is empty
  o fixed multiple memory leaks, e.g., triggered by switching into fullscreen
    mode
  o fixed -clipboard 0/clipboard=0 argument parsing (now actually disables
    clipboard handling)
  o fixed x2goagent.xpm logo and nxagent.xpm loading times
  o dropped external icon (startup logo) loading support
  o fixed keyboard conversion handling on reconnects
  o added support for a custom version string (build-time only)
  o use nxdialog as nxclient replacement if available in /usr/bin
  o centered logo drawing
  o added missing documentation to man page (-irlimit, copysize, -defer, -tile)
  o packaged nxdialog for RPM platforms
  o improved caps- and numlock handling
  o fixed resizing bug with mutter
  o fixed nxagent not responding to resume event
  o fixed unresponsive mouse (buttons) in fullscreen mode
  o added fullscreen=2 nxagent option mode to start nxagent spanning only one
    screen and -geometry/geometry={allscreens,onescreen} options
  o support musl libc in Mesa code
  o misc. backports from X.Org
  o misc. code cleanup


Additionally, this version contains build fixes for newer distributions that are
not included in the upstream release, mentioned in the changelog below.


X2Go Component: nx-libs
Version: 2:3.5.99.26
Status: RELEASE
Timestamp: 1685729433
Date: Fri, 02 Jun 2023 20:10:33 +0200
Changes:
 nx-libs (3.5.99.26) RELEASED; urgency=medium
 .
   [ Mike Gabriel ]
   * Upstream-provided Debian package for nx-libs.
     See upstream ChangeLog for recent changes.
   * debian/rules:
     + Define -DUseTIRPC=1 for nx-X11 build on Debian and Ubuntu versions that
       already have libtirpc.
 .
   [ Mihai Moldovan ]
   * nx-libs.spec:
     + Fix nxdialog hashbang selection, especially on *SuSE.
     + Add BR: upon pathfix.py.
     + Fix TIRPC usage on *SuSE 15.3+.
     + Only depend upon pathfix.py for Fedora 27+ and RHEL 7+. On older
       systems, use a less sophisticated way to replace the hashbang.
   * debian/rules:
     + Fix version detection on testing and unstable.
 .
   [ ponce ]
   * Backported to 3.5.99.26:
     - Fix building with binutils >= 2.36. The l option of ar in the newer
       binutils versions switched from being unused to being used to specify
       dependencies so here should be safely removed.


Regards,



Mihai Moldovan

Attachment: OpenPGP_signature
Description: OpenPGP digital signature

_______________________________________________
x2go-announcements mailing list
x2go-announcements@lists.x2go.org
https://lists.x2go.org/listinfo/x2go-announcements

Reply via email to